so we've had quite a few rain storms here in sunny SoCal as of late. Great! ....except my front passenger floor board got soaked. I searched on the subject and got everything from heater core to sunroof drains and windshield gasket. Well my coolant level is fine and it only got wet when it rained and only on the floor, not up the front footwell wall. Not the heater core (although the color of the water was similar to the coolant i think the carpets are just plain dirty). I've cleaned the sunroof drains. Lastly i know my windshield gasket is starting to leak over the front DS A-pillar so i'm guessing it could be failing other places.

Anyone have any other recommendations or should i just plan on changing the windshield and related gaskets. I could do silicone bead along the bottom and see if it leaks next rain....

what do you think?

this just happened to me, wet floors etc. I had a leak in the same place(A piller DS) Come to find out I have an aftermarket windshield and according to a few guys here on mud they dont fit as well as factory windshields. So rather then dropping the dough for a new gasket, I went to the Kragen auto and bought some clear silicone. Then I went to town on the glass where it meets the gasket and the metal where it meets the gasket. Im not sure what the end result will be(waiting for rain) but it sooks pretty water tight.
